If he gobbled 70 yards away, I wouldn't have ever made another sound besides scratching in the leaves and maybe a couple purrs. Don't ever put your decoys right beside you. That is a sure way to get busted. If anything you should have put your decoy right where you were standing when he first gobbled and eased back about 15-20 yards and set down. Also, if you were just running a hen decoy, chances are, even if he did see it, he wasn't going to come in. I have had many birds, when I used to only put out a hen, that would see the decoy and strut and gobble back and forth for a very long time and never budge. However, this early in the season, if there is a jake decoy with her, its usually game on. Late in the season a single hen will work. You know the area he is in now and slip back out there set up and kill him.
